Abstract

This article explores the clinical-anatomical considerations underlying the opening and drainage of phlegmon in the eye area. Phlegmon, characterized by localized tissue inflammation and infection, poses significant challenges in ophthalmology. The study delves into the anatomical intricacies of the eye region, reviews relevant literature, presents methodologies for surgical intervention, reports results, engages in a comprehensive discussion, and concludes with suggestions for future research and clinical practice.
